【问题标题】:Google Map Not Working through IP Address谷歌地图无法通过 IP 地址工作
【发布时间】:2017-08-01 20:25:09
【问题描述】:

我正在将 Google Map 集成到我的 asp.net 应用程序中。首先,我将简要介绍我想要实现的整体功能。

当用户登录网站时,他/她会在主页的地图中看到当前位置。通过下拉菜单选择特定车辆后,我需要根据地图上所选车辆的数据库中存储的数据显示最新位置(纬度和经度)。

我只完成了第一部分,即在登录时加载当前位置。 它在我的本地主机上运行良好,但是当我将应用程序上传到我的生产服务器以通过 IP(内部和公共)访问它来测试它时,地图不会加载。

我在生产服务器上上传了我的应用程序源代码并运行了该应用程序。它工作正常,但是如果我通过服务器的 IP 发布和访问它,它不会加载。

我请求帮助我解决这个问题。

感谢和问候, 克鲁纳尔。沙霍利亚

【问题讨论】:

  • 你能在浏览器控制台看到任何错误信息吗?
  • 是的,我可以看到 5 个错误。它说谷歌地图的 getcurrentposition() 和 watchposition 函数现在只能用于安全来源。我需要将 SSL 证书添加到我的应用程序 (https)。

标签: javascript asp.net google-maps


【解决方案1】:

每个 IP 有一个每日限制,例如 2,500 个,以获取由 Google 地图解析的地理编码。你有没有达到这个极限?

【讨论】:

  • 这个每日限制的来源是什么?
  • 我刚刚完成了一个项目,使用谷歌地图解析数千个地理编码。一旦达到每日 2,500 个限制,您将收到来自 Google 的通知,说您无法根据每日报价解析更多地理编码。
  • 你能告诉我如何检查我是否达到了每日限额。此外,据我所知,我的申请达到每日限额的可能性非常小。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2016-09-28
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2018-11-14
  • 1970-01-01
相关资源
最近更新 更多